Distinguish between a partnership at will and a particular partnership.

Basis of
Distinction
Partnership at Will Particular Partnership
Definition A partnership is formed indefinitely; no fixed time or purpose is mentioned at formation. A partnership formed for a specified time period or for a specific venture.
Duration It can continue for any length of time, depending on the partners’ will. Automatically dissolved on the expiry of the specified period or on completion of the specific purpose.
Dissolution Can be dissolved by any partner giving notice to others of their desire to quit the firm. Dissolves automatically when the specific time period ends or the purpose is achieved.
Nature of Existence Indefinite and ongoing until any partner decides to dissolve. Limited and tied to a particular venture or time frame.
